Inotersen sodium, also known as ISIS-420915 sodium, is a 2′-O-methoxyethyl-modified antisense oligonucleotide compound. It effectively inhibits transthyretin (TTR) protein production by targeting the TTR RNA transcript, thereby reducing TTR transcript levels. Inotersen sodium holds potential for research on hereditary TTR amyloidosis polyneuropathy.

In vitro | Inotersen sodium, at concentrations ranging from 0.16 to 20 μM over a 16-hour period, effectively decreases TTR mRNA levels in HepG2 cells in a dose-dependent manner[1]. |
In vivo | Inotersen sodium, administered subcutaneously at doses ranging from 10-100 mg/kg twice weekly for 4 weeks, significantly reduces plasma transthyretin (TTR) protein levels by over 80% in transgenic mice carrying the Ile84Ser human TTR mutation[1]. |
